Explore Macon: A Traveler's Guide

Located in the heart of Georgia, Macon is a charming city filled with history, culture, and natural beauty. Whether you are a history buff, outdoor enthusiast, or food lover, Macon has something for everyone. Here are some must-see attractions and activities to make the most of your visit:

Historic Sites

1. Ocmulgee Mounds National Historical Park: Explore ancient Native American mounds and learn about the region's history.

2. Hay House: Visit this stunning antebellum mansion filled with period furnishings and art.

Cultural Attractions

1. Tubman Museum: Discover the art, history, and culture of African Americans in the Southeast.

2. Douglas Theatre: Enjoy a live performance at one of the oldest African American theatres in the country.

Outdoor Adventures

1. Amerson River Park: Take a hike, rent a kayak, or have a picnic in this beautiful riverside park.

2. Whitewater Rafting on the Ocmulgee River: Experience the thrill of navigating rapids in the heart of Macon.

3. Central City Park: Enjoy the green spaces, playgrounds, and walking trails in the heart of the city.

Local Cuisine

1. H&H Restaurant: Taste traditional Southern dishes at this iconic eatery frequented by music legends.

2. Fincher's Bar-B-Q: Indulge in delicious barbecue that has been a Macon favorite for generations.

Plan Your Visit

Don't miss out on all that Macon has to offer. Plan your trip to coincide with one of the city's many festivals, such as the Cherry Blossom Festival in the spring or the Bragg Jam Music Festival in the summer.
